Sophos Management Service won't start

I've installed SEC 5.2.1 and specified a different port.  Now the Management Service won't start, event log shows:

ID 8004

Initialization failed.

Step: Creating a database connection
Error: std::runtime_error
Data: [DBNETLIB][ConnectionOpen (ParseConnectParams()).]Invalid connection.

ID 8025

There is no database connection. Management Service will be shut down.

I can confirm that the SophosManagement user is a member of the Sophos DB Admins local group. Is this because of the different port number, and how can I fix?
